Haley. Congratulations to Gov. Nikki Haley on improved poll numbers among Democrats and African Americans. See what can happen if you work more across the aisle?

Continental Tire. Great to hear Sumter’s tire plant is adding 900 jobs to increase annual production to 8 million tires.

Hot air. We’ve always known there is a lot of hot air IN South Carolina. Now we know there’s a bunch offshore — to potentially power lots of wind turbines to generate electricity.

Colbert. Hats off to Charleston’s own Stephen Colbert for a successful kick-off to a new late night show on CBS.

S.C. State. Some good news for the university that’s been troubled over the past few years. Enrollment and revenue numbers are up more than projected. More.

Area code. Some change is hard, such as having to dial new area codes. That’s what’s happening in the Pee Dee where a new 854 area code soon will overlap with the 843 area code. For everyone in the Pee Dee and Lowcountry, it will mean dialing either area code all of the time — even with local calls. More.
